A plan to redevelop Washington’s 3rd Street Park site into a mixed-use area with commercial and recreational spaces is open for public input.
A draft proposal for redeveloping 3rd Street Park and boating access in Washington, formerly the site of the Pamlico Chemical facility, has been released, introducing plans for new commercial spaces to boost public access and economic activity.
The project, part of broader urban revitalization efforts, is open for public feedback and aims to create a mixed-use area combining recreation, environmental preservation, and local commerce.
